What to Look for in a Local Boonton Junk Removal Service
First, prioritize licensed and insured companies. This protects you and your property. Ask about their disposal practices—reputable haulers in our area often partner with local donation centers like the Boonton United Methodist Church's periodic collection drives or recycling facilities to divert items from landfills whenever possible. For larger items like appliances or electronics, ensure they follow New Jersey's specific disposal regulations. Many services offer free, no-obligation estimates, which is crucial for budgeting your project.
Boonton-Specific Tips for Your Haul
Living in our historic town comes with unique considerations. Many homes in Boonton's older neighborhoods have narrow driveways, limited street parking, or multiple flights of stairs. When calling for an estimate, mention these access challenges. A professional crew will come prepared and can often advise on the best approach. Also, be mindful of Boonton's local bulk pickup schedule through the Department of Public Works; sometimes scheduling a private hauler is more convenient than waiting for the municipal pickup, especially for immediate projects.
Preparing for Your Junk Removal Day
To get the most value and efficiency, do a little prep work. Sort your items into three categories: definite trash, potential donations, and "maybes." This helps the crew work faster. If you have hazardous materials like paint, chemicals, or batteries, set those aside, as most standard junk removal services cannot take them. The Morris County MUA in nearby Mount Olive often hosts household hazardous waste collection days—a better solution for those items. Finally, clear a path to the junk, both inside and outside your home, to ensure a safe and quick removal process.
